How to Choose the Right Materials for Your Custom Banners Johannesburg
Johannesburg is famous for sudden afternoon thunderstorms and harsh high-veld sun. If your banners aren’t built for the event environment, your branding could end up faded or torn before the event ends. Here’s what to consider for your exhibition banner printing in Johannesburg:
- Heavy-Duty Materials for Outdoors: Ask your banner printers in Johannesburg for a thicker vinyl to prevent the banner from curling or snapping in the elements.
- Branded Flags for Foot Traffic: Flags are a great choice for open areas because they move with the air and catch the eye of people walking from any direction.
- Wind-Friendly Mesh for Fences: Mesh has tiny holes that let the breeze blow through your banner, which prevents it from acting like a sail and blowing away.
How to Design Event Banners in Johannesburg
Designing a small flyer is very different from designing for large-format printing in Johannesburg. A common mistake is cluttering the banner with too much text, which makes it difficult to read from a distance. Here’s how to catch a customer’s eye in a few seconds:
- High-Resolution Graphics: Avoid blurry images, especially for exhibition banner printing in Johannesburg, where people will see your branding up close.
- The Rule of Three: Keep your design simple. Use one bold headline, one great photo, and one clear instruction on what the customer should do next.
- Colour Contrast: Use high-contrast combinations. A dark background with light text will make your message legible even in poorly lit venues.
